- Indicator &1 not allowed ?The SAP error message ESH_QM_EXEC002, which states "Indicator &1 not allowed," typically occurs in the context of the SAP Enterprise Search or Query Management functionalities. This error indicates that a specific indicator (represented by &1) is not permitted in the current context or configuration.
Cause: Invalid Indicator: The indicator you are trying to use may not be valid for the specific query or search context.
Configuration Issues: There may be configuration settings in the SAP system that restrict the use of certain indicators.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to use the specified indicator. Data Model Issues: The data model or the search index may not support the indicator being referenced.
